Transaction 8f91681800589e30e74388102abb7bc56a1c80c8258c338972f42ec3c3696331
1 Input
1 Output
-
8f91681800589e30e74388102abb7bc56a1c80c8258c338972f42ec3c3696331:0
- value
- 23164295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b34c4b1e4b855bbd89289124822f63d951f62a6 OP_EQUAL
- address
- 3A1GdQfXrqhAgkLbNQfJBjMVkwHMePGy1w